Ford, in an attempt to up its game in the festive season, has launched the signature edition range of accessories on one of it's most awarded compact SUVs, the EcoSport. The car will now feature attractive exteriors and sportier looking interiors. The signature edition of the black Titanium variant of Ford EcoSport will be available at a starting price of Rs 9,26,194 (Ex-Showroom, Delhi). The aforementioned ex-showroom price will be inclusive of accessories, fitments, and a paint job (worth Rs 37,894).
On the outside, the Ford EcoSport's black signature edition will feature a series of changes that enhance the sporty appeal of the car. The new features will include all-new LED daytime running lamps (DRL), a string of five LED lights that have been added just below the fog lamp, tweaked front and rear bumpers, attractive body graphics and bright and illuminated scuff plates.
The parts of the new signature edition package will be dealer fitted on the existing EcoSport Black. The package will include all-black exteriors along with a black grille, black-out moulded headlamps, 16-inch black alloy wheels, black mirror covers, black fog lamp bezel, black roof rails and roof cross bars.
Speaking of the interiors, the car will feature black vinyl seat covers with red stitching which will give the interiors a plush, premium, and a completely fresh look. AppLink, Ford’s advanced in-car connectivity system, life-saving Emergency Assistance and six airbags (for the top-end variant) for an enhanced level of protection for the driver and as well passengers, are some of the additional features on the compact SUV.
Under the hood of the compact SUV is a 1.5-litre TiVCT petrol engine that produces 112 PS of power. On the other hand, the 1.5-litre TDCi oil burner is capable of churning out 100 PS of power. Both these motors come with either a five-speed manual transmission or Ford’s renowned six-speed dual clutch PowerShift automatic transmission, depending upon the buyer's choice.
The Ford EcoSport has won 32 awards till now, which makes it one of the most awarded vehicles in the country. The car was also declared as the best SUV in terms of quality twice in a row by the JD Power Study.
